题目

[问答题]有一个工程文件ylc6.vbp,它的功能是在文本框中输入一个整数,单击“移动”按钮后,如果输入的是正数,滚动条中的滚动框向右移动与该数相等的刻度,但如果超过了滚动条的最大刻度,则不移动,并且显示“文本框中的数值太大”;如果输入的是负数,则滚动框向左移动与该数相等的刻度,但如果超过了滚动条的最小刻度,则不移动,并且显示“文本框中的数值太小”,如图18所示。

题目中提供的“移动”按钮控件Command1的Click事件的源代码如下:
PrivateSubCommand1_Click()
DimnCountAsInteger
nCount=CInt(Text1.Text)
If(nCount>=)Then
HScroll1.Value=HScroll1.Max
Else
If(nCount<=HScroll1.Min)Then
=HScroll1.Min
MsgBox("文本框中的数字太小")
Else
HScroll1.Value=
EndIf
EndIf
EndSub
注意:不能修改程序中的其他部分,不能修改控件的属性,最后把修改后的程序以原来的文件名存盘。存盘时必须存放在考生文件夹下。

答案
查看答案
相关试题
[填空题]在AWT包中,创建一个具有10行、45列的多行文本区域对象ta的语句是【12】。
[填空题]Swing的项层容器有:JApplet、JWindow、JDialog和______。
[单项选择题]以下程序段的输出结果为()
Dima(10),p(3)
k=5
Fori=0To10
a(i)=i
Nexti
Fori=0To2
p(i)=a(i+(i+1))
Nexti
Fori=0To2
k=k+p(i)+2
Nexti
Printk
A.20
B.21
C.56
D.32
[单项选择题]窗体上有一个名称为Picture1的图片控件,一个名称为Timer的计时器控件,其Interval属性值为1000。要求每隔5秒钟图片框右移100。现编写程序如下:PrivateSubTimer1_Timer()StaticnAsIntegern=n+1If(n/5)=Int(n/5)AndPicture1.LeftPicture1.Left=Picture1.Left+100EndIfEndSub分析以上程序,以下叙述中正确的是()。
A.程序中没有设置5秒钟的时间,所以不能每隔5秒移动图片框一次
B.此程序运行时图片框位置保持不动
C.此程序运行时图片框移动方向与题目要求相反
D.If语句条件中“Picture1.Left
[填空题]下列的程序的功能是简单的进行键盘输入测试,请补充完整程序。  importjavax.swing.*;  publicclassTestzzz  {publicstaticvoidmain(String[]args)   {Stringname=JOptionPane. 【】 ("Whatisyourname");    System.out.println("Hello"+name);    System.exit(0);   }  }
最新解答的试题
提出现代生物-心理-社会医学模式是()

A.恩格尔B.波特C.托马斯·帕茨瓦尔D.比彻尔E.桑德斯
付款人在进行付款时无()

A.形式审查义务

B.实质审查义务

C.附带审查义务

D.票据外有关事项的审查义务
根据《公司法》的规定,有限责任公司下列人员中,可以提议召开股东会临时会议的是()。
A.总经理B.人数过半数的股东C.监事会主席D.人数为半数的董事
关于股份有限公司中的监事会,下列说法错误的是()

A.监事会负责提议聘请或更换外部审计机构B.监事会主席和副主席由全体监事过半数选举产生C.监事会中的职工代表的比例不得低于三分之一D.监事会应至少每6个月召开一次会议
三北精神的科学内涵